What Should You Do for Your Audition and Monologue?

If you'd like to audition for an acting role, sign up for an audition time on the sheet outside of the choir room (time slots are for Thursday, March 13th), and then prepare a 1-2 minute monologue. While it's ideal to memorize your monologue script, it's not completely necessary. At least get familiar enough with it so that you don't need to absolutely be glued to it throughout your monologue. We just want to see your ability to communicate with your body and voice.
